Awesome...thank you. I did this mod today along with the grill mod. I had to add wire on the driver's side though. My wiring was ran between the fender and kinda pinched in there. There was really not much slack so I just spliced in a wire a routed with the rest. It came out really good. I actually soldered the wires and taped them up so I shouldn't have any issues later. Ran them all together again so it looks factory and is hidden well. I think this is a great mod especially driving around in Los Angeles traffic. Thanks for the easy mod.
